Transaction 0acbcab70b12099722f686fc31493e1fdb9a9ee4d7ad59939eb886a4e4076e71

92 Input
2 Outputs
  • 0acbcab70b12099722f686fc31493e1fdb9a9ee4d7ad59939eb886a4e4076e71:0
  • value  1171106
    address  3QszrHg4pGhj8EsgdM9YwwbxqhRYDvbKx5
  • 0acbcab70b12099722f686fc31493e1fdb9a9ee4d7ad59939eb886a4e4076e71:1
  • value  2186593769
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s